[高血压型神经循环无力症患者在7天“干”浸期间的直立耐力及中枢和外周血流动力学状态]

[Orthostatic tolerance and the status of central and peripheral hemodynamics during 7-day "dry" immersion in persons with neurocirculatory asthenia of the hypertensive type].

Abstract

Eleven healthy male volunteers, aged 45-55 years, with neurocirculatory dystonia of the hypertensive type were exposed to 7-day dry immersion. The following parameters were measured: central and peripheral hemodynamics (by the method of rheography), linear blood flow velocity, and orthostatic tolerance before and after immersion. During an acute period of adaptation to immersion the test subjects developed: centralization of blood filling of the head and lungs, decrease of stroke volume and cardiac output, increase of linear blood flow velocity in forearm arteries and its decrease in leg arteries, drastic decline of orthostatic tolerance.

摘要

11名年龄在45至55岁之间、患有高血压型神经循环性肌张力障碍的健康男性志愿者接受了为期7天的干浸试验。测量了以下参数:中心和外周血流动力学(通过血流描记法)、线性血流速度以及浸浴前后的直立耐力。在适应浸浴的急性期,受试者出现了:头部和肺部血液充盈的集中化、每搏输出量和心输出量的减少、前臂动脉线性血流速度的增加及其在腿部动脉中的降低、直立耐力的急剧下降。
